A brilliantly talented photographer and master of her craft, Laura Stevens was initially introduced to us by our friends over at MPrint. Currently residing in Paris, Laura’s images feel at home in the fine art realm; her work is intimate and aesthetically romantic, with subdued tones and painterly light.
Framing her subjects with subtle, cinematic compositions, we’re drawn in by the sense of calm within the environment and the quiet voyeurism in Laura’s work that alludes to an unknown narrative and ambiguous air. With influences of both cinema and Renaissance, Laura’s use of light, colour, and texture, create sombre tones that stir up feelings of longing and loneliness.
Laura’s standout images portray themes of love and relationship, intimate stories of vulnerability and the evolving chapters of life after loss. Captured through the female gaze, Laura’s work is a combination of both constructed portraits and images with an observational narrative - all beautifully shot through a tender lens.
